What a Gawler Property Market Appraisal Involves



A market assessment in Gawler SA is not an agent walking through and naming a price. The process is built from a combination of hard evidence from completed transactions and a grounded understanding of how active the buyer pool is.

What catches people off guard is how meaningfully a house with the same floor plan can produce different outcomes depending on micro-location factors that online tools simply miss. A specialist with real Gawler market knowledge understands this instinctively — online calculators will not.



Alongside the data, a complete appraisal factors in how the property sits relative to other active listings. What else is on the market has a measurable effect on where to position the asking figure.



How Local Conditions Are Shaping Property Sales in Gawler



The present selling environment in Gawler SA rewards homeowners who approach the process with clarity. Market participation has continued to be healthy — but purchasers active in Gawler are also well informed.



Overpriced properties are identified fast in today's information-rich environment. Days on market accumulate quickly and raise questions that undermines the campaign even after adjustments are made.



Those who begin with an honest figure avoid this entirely. Enquiry comes in quickly — and initial buyer interest is consistently the period that produces the outcome sellers are hoping for.



What Influences a House Value Estimate in the Gawler Region



Getting an accurate house value estimate in Gawler SA demands more than relying on a desktop estimate. What it actually takes an informed, on-the-ground assessment.



Property assessments vary across Gawler for several reasons. Micro-position, land size relative to neighbouring properties, quality of any renovations and proximity to schools, transport and retail amenity all generate different figures even between properties that look similar on paper. The difference separating a rough online estimate and an accurate, appraisal-based assessment can be more than most sellers expect in either direction. That gap is the argument for why a physical appraisal by someone who knows the area is worth doing.



Understanding the Buyer Side of the Gawler Property Market



Knowing what buyers are actually looking for in the Gawler SA area gives sellers a meaningful edge. What the active buyer pool values in Gawler have remained driven by practical family-friendly features and affordability compared to inner-city options.



Families relocating from metropolitan Adelaide make up a meaningful share of the current buyer pool in Gawler. This group acts quickly when a listing aligns with what they are looking for — particularly if the asking price reflects genuine market value.



Investment purchasing also plays a role across certain pockets of the market — most notably where strong rental demand supports investment returns. Being clear on who is most likely to purchase your specific property is one of the reasons why an agent with genuine area knowledge adds real and measurable value.
